TURN-208: Gatevale turnstile counters at the Merrow Field pilot double-count when a rotation reverses mid-cycle. Attendance totals drift roughly 2% high per event. The debounce window fix is implemented, reviewed by Ilsa, and soak-tested across two simulated match days without drift. Ready for your cut; the candidate build is identified below.

trace token, tagag-tafog: htk6_5ed18c

## Tuning

FeeCrafter's rules engine decides shipping fees per order, and yes, the defaults are opinionated. If a merchant on the Parcelgrove plan complains about weird surcharges, it's almost always one of the knobs below rather than a bug. Changing a value takes effect on the next rule reload, so no restart needed — just don't crank the distance multiplier without checking with eng. Current defaults follow.

tuning table, kageg-kagap:
CAPS = {
    "druox": 842,
    "quenax": 605,
    "zormir": 107,
    "tamwyn": 577,
    "kasok": 688,
}

## Plugins: hooking undo/redo

Sketchloom's diagram editor exposes undo and redo through the `HistoryBus`. Plugins must not mutate nodes directly; wrap every change in a `Transaction` so it lands on the undo stack. Redo is automatic if your transaction is pure — no timers, no network calls inside. Test with `SKL_HISTORY_DEPTH=200` in your local `.env` to catch stack-overflow bugs early. Publishing a plugin to the Sketchloom registry requires the build tool to sign your bundle, and that signing credential goes on the following line.

env line for bagap-yajep: COURIER_KEY20=b4db4e5e33a646898766